Synergy
Synergy is a series of skill building and training workshops to
aid students in the development of their leadership style and personal
development. An integral component of Synergy is to prepare participants
to utilize critical thinking, to develop effective verbal, non-verbal
and written communication skills, how to delegate and collaborative
and cooperative teamwork. Students can attend workshops “a-la-carte”
or they can apply to the Leadership Academy – a track based,
intensive leadership and skill developing program. Successful completion
of the Leadership Academy culminates with a graduation ceremony
and recognition as a certified student leader.
